I made the sketch and began painting using a soft brush and skin colors in shades of pink. On a new layer, I added more colors, this time using a hard brush and intensifying the shadows on the left side. Again, I took the soft brush and began blending the colors to achieve a visually smooth skin tone.

For the hair, I used a light brown shade and painted it using the diffuse brush. Then I started drawing bruises in the area under the eyes, painted the eyebrows and eyelashes, and, as always, I wanted to add some white highlights to accentuate the eyes, nose, and cheekbones. Finally, I made a color adjustment, intensifying the colors a little more.


Tools:
- Photoshop CC 2022
- XP-PEN Deco Pro
